Holodeck SMP Server

Holodeck SMP Server is a service meta-data publisher that provides capability information of Participants in a data exchange network. It is commonly used in four-corner networks, such as Peppol and the Business Payments Coalition’s (BPC) E-invoice Exchange Market Pilot to find the Access Point of the Service Provider that handles the exchange of documents, like invoices and orders, on behalf of the Participant. The current version supports the OASIS Standard Service Metadata Publishing (SMP) version 2.0 as used by the Business Payments Coalation (BPC) and the Peppol specification. It also supports basic integration with the Peppol SML.

The server contains two separated interfaces, a REST based API for responding to queries and a web-based user interface for managing of the Participant's capabilities. By separating the query and management interfaces it is easy to manage access to them independently.
